The weather trackside in Brisbane today is for a partly cloudy but otherwise fine day and, without any rain on the radar, the current Good (4) Eagle Farm track rating looks set to stay across the card.
Brisbane racing gets underway this morning at 11:34am (AEST) and the exciting nine-race program continues through until the fillies and mares face off in the Listed $150,000 Magic Millions Helen Coughlan Stakes at 4:34pm (AEST).
The first Group race on the line-up is scheduled as Race 3 when the undefeated Ayrton is at short-odds to salute in the Group 3 Fred Best Classic (1400m) before tackling the 2021 Stradbroke Handicap in a fortnight.
The richest race on the card is the Group 2 $1 million BRC Sires’ Produce Stakes (1400m) for the J.J. Atkins-bound two-year-olds and it is another undefeated youngster in the Robert Heathcote-trained Prince Of Boom tipped to take out the million-dollar feature.
Elite level racing kicks off with Race 7 at 3:18pm (AEST) and it is a class field gathered for the Group 1 $600,000 Queensland Derby over the mile and a half.
The 2021 Queensland Derby odds online at Ladbrokes.com.au favour the gun three-year-old of the season, the ATC Derby – SA Derby champion Explosive Jack who dominates the markets on the capacity field.
The meeting’s marquee race follows with the Group 1 $700,000 Kingsford-Smith Cup over 1300m set to run as Eagle Farm Race 8 at 3:58pm (AEST).
The Kingsford-Smith Cup field is down to 15 starters with the withdrawal of the widely-drawn Imaging for Chris Waller who had the outside alley.
